Alexander Onischuk wins the SPICE Cup Print
Tuesday, 09 November 2010 07:25
A crucial last round victory against the future star Ray Robson propelled the former US champion Alexander Onischuk to the clear first place in the 2010 SPICE Cup GMA. German GM Georg Meier enjoyed a one point advantage prior to the final act, but the Blbao scoring system (3 points for a win, 1 for draw, 0 for loss) favoured decisive games.

Final standings:
1. Alexander Onischuk - 18 points
2. Georg Meier - 17
3-4. Wesley So and Zoltan Almasi - 14
5-6. Ray Robson and Eugene Perelshtein - 7


GM Anatoly Bykhovsky and IM Gergely Antal shared the first place in SPICE Cup GMB with 6.0 points each. This tournament was a 10-player round robin.

GM Georgi Kacheishvili (Georgia) won the 2010 SPICE Cup FIDE Open with the score of 5.5 / 6.
